.row .grid_12 #form1 {
	color: #FFFFFF;
	font-size: 20px;
	line-height: 42px;
	font-family: open-sans;
	font-style: normal;
	font-weight: 300;
}
#nomcourriel label #nomcomplet {
	width: calc(100% - 20px);
	height: 31px;
	
}
#nomcourriel label #courriel {
	width: calc(100% - 20px);
	height: 31px;
}
#form1 label #message {
	width: calc(100% - 20px);
	height: 156px;
	
}
#nomcomplet:hover, #courriel:hover, #message:hover {
	background-color: #FFFBC5;
}
.submit {
	width: 120px;
	height: 38px;
	background-color: #FFFFFF;
	font-family: "Lucida Grande", "Lucida Sans Unicode", "Lucida Sans", "DejaVu Sans", Verdana, sans-serif;
	font-size: 18px;
	border: thin solid #000;
	margin-top: 5px;
	/* -- CSS3 Transition - define which property to animate (i.e. the shadow)  -- */
	-webkit-transition: -webkit-box-shadow 0.3s linear;
	/* -- CSS3 Shadow - create a shadow around each input element -- */ 
	/* [disabled]background: -webkit-gradient(linear, 0% 0%, 0% 100%, from(#FCEC5A), to(#0a85a8)); */
	border-radius: 0px;
	font-style: normal;
	font-weight: 300;
}

input.submit:hover {
	/* [disabled]-webkit-box-shadow: 0px 0px 9px #7B7B7B; */
	/* [disabled]-moz-box-shadow: 0px 0px 9px #ccc; */
	/* [disabled]box-shadow: 0px 0px 9px #7B7B7B; */
	cursor: pointer;
	background-color: #FFF402;
}
